Understanding Your Target Audience
Before implementing any marketing strategy, it's essential to know who your target audience is. Understanding their needs, preferences, and behaviors will allow you to tailor your marketing efforts effectively. Here are some steps to identify your audience:
Conduct Market Research: Use surveys, interviews, and focus groups to gather insights about your potential customers.
Analyze Competitors: Look at who your competitors are targeting and how they engage with their audience.
Create Buyer Personas: Develop detailed profiles of your ideal customers, including demographics, interests, and pain points.
By knowing your audience, you can create more relevant and engaging marketing campaigns.
Building a Strong Online Presence
In the digital age, having a robust online presence is vital for business growth. Here are some strategies to enhance your online visibility:
Develop a User-Friendly Website
Your website is often the first point of contact for potential customers. Ensure it is:
Responsive: Optimize for mobile devices to reach users on the go.
Fast: Improve loading times to reduce bounce rates.
Informative: Provide valuable content that addresses customer needs.
Utilize Search Engine Optimization (SEO)
SEO helps your website rank higher in search engine results, making it easier for customers to find you. Focus on:
Keyword Research: Identify relevant keywords your audience is searching for.
On-Page SEO: Optimize your website's content, meta tags, and images.
Link Building: Acquire backlinks from reputable sites to boost your authority.
Leverage Content Marketing
Creating valuable content can establish your brand as an authority in your industry. Consider:
Blogging: Share insights, tips, and industry news to engage your audience.
Videos: Use video content to explain complex topics or showcase products.
Infographics: Present data and information visually to make it more digestible.
Engaging with Social Media
Social media platforms are powerful tools for connecting with your audience. Here are some effective strategies:
Choose the Right Platforms
Not all social media platforms will be suitable for your business. Identify where your target audience spends their time and focus your efforts there. For example:
Instagram: Great for visual brands and younger audiences.
LinkedIn: Ideal for B2B companies and professional networking.
Facebook: Offers a broad reach across various demographics.
Create Engaging Content
To capture attention on social media, your content must be engaging. Consider:
Interactive Posts: Use polls, quizzes, and questions to encourage participation.
User-Generated Content: Share content created by your customers to build community.
Live Videos: Host live sessions to interact with your audience in real-time.
Monitor and Respond
Engagement is a two-way street. Monitor your social media channels for comments and messages, and respond promptly to foster relationships with your audience.
Email Marketing
Email marketing remains one of the most effective ways to reach your audience. Here’s how to make the most of it:
Build a Quality Email List
Focus on growing a list of engaged subscribers. Use strategies like:
Lead Magnets: Offer free resources (e.g., eBooks, checklists) in exchange for email addresses.
Sign-Up Forms: Place forms on your website and social media to capture leads.
Personalize Your Campaigns
Personalization can significantly improve your email marketing results. Consider:
Segmenting Your List: Group subscribers based on interests or behaviors for targeted messaging.
Dynamic Content: Use personalized content based on subscriber data to increase relevance.
Analyze and Optimize
Regularly review your email marketing performance. Track metrics like open rates, click-through rates, and conversions to identify areas for improvement.
Networking and Partnerships
Building relationships with other businesses can open new opportunities for growth. Here are some strategies:
Attend Industry Events
Participating in conferences, trade shows, and networking events can help you connect with potential partners and customers. Be prepared to:
Share Your Story: Have a clear and concise pitch about your business.
Collect Contacts: Exchange business cards and follow up after the event.
Collaborate with Other Brands
Partnering with complementary businesses can expand your reach. Consider:
Joint Promotions: Offer bundled products or services to attract new customers.
Co-Hosting Events: Organize workshops or webinars together to share expertise.
Utilizing Data Analytics
Data analytics can provide valuable insights into your marketing efforts. Here’s how to leverage it:
Track Key Performance Indicators (KPIs)
Identify the KPIs that matter most to your business, such as:
Conversion Rates: Measure how many leads turn into customers.
Customer Acquisition Cost: Calculate how much you spend to acquire a new customer.
Use Analytics Tools
Invest in tools like Google Analytics, social media analytics, and email marketing software to gather data. Analyze this information to:
Identify Trends: Understand what strategies are working and which need adjustment.
Make Informed Decisions: Use data to guide your marketing strategy and budget allocation.
